People who are physically reliant to drugs or alcohol and want assistance will first go through detoxification before receiving other treatment services in drug rehab. Detox is simply the process of the drug being eradicated from one's system, which is often uncomfortable and may carry risks if not performed in a setting which can provide appropriate support and medical intervention as required. Detox services are offered at either a professional drug or alcohol detoxification facility or a drug treatment facility which can adequately oversee and present medical supervision for persons who are just coming off of drugs. Detoxification services typically include insuring the individual is as relaxed as possible while detoxing and going through drug or alcohol withdrawal, delivering proper nutrition and making certain the particular person is getting proper rest, and providing supplements and medicine as necessary to make the detox process as easy and safe as possible. The person in detoxification will sometimes be encouraged to take part in some sort of physical activity such as walking, yoga, etc. At a drug detoxification facility or drug rehab facility which can supply detox services, the client will have detoxification staff at their disposal around the clock to assure that any complications are handled as swiftly and safely as possible.
